mysql導出sql文件命令詳解

一、mysql導出sql文件命令

在MySQL中,有一個非常重要的操作就是導出數據庫。導出數據庫的主要目的是備份數據或將數據遷移到另一個數據庫中。MySQL提供了多種方式來導出數據庫,其中最常用的方法是使用mysqldump命令。示例代碼如下:

mysqldump -u用戶名 -p密碼 數據庫名 > 導出文件名

其中,用戶名和密碼分別是你的MySQL登錄賬戶和密碼,數據庫名是你要導出的數據庫名稱,導出文件名是你自己指定的導出文件名稱,不需要加文件後綴。運行該命令後,MySQL會將數據庫導出到指定的文件中。

二、mysql導出的sql文件在哪

在進行數據庫導出時,需要指定導出文件的路徑和名稱。對於Linux系統,如果不指定路徑,導出文件會默認保存到當前用戶的home目錄下。如果指定了路徑,則導出文件會保存到指定的路徑下。示例代碼如下:

mysqldump -u用戶名 -p密碼 數據庫名 > /home/user/導出文件名

對於Windows系統,如果不指定路徑,導出文件會默認保存到MySQL安裝目錄的bin目錄下。如果指定了路徑,則導出文件會保存到指定的路徑下。示例代碼如下:

mysqldump -u用戶名 -p密碼 數據庫名 > C:\mysql\導出文件名

三、mysql workbench導出sql文件

MySQL Workbench是MySQL官方推出的一款可視化數據庫管理工具。通過MySQL Workbench可以方便地對數據庫進行管理和操作,包括導出數據庫。在MySQL Workbench中導出數據庫,可以利用導出嚮導完成。具體步驟如下:

1、在MySQL Workbench中選擇要導出的數據庫,在導航欄中右鍵單擊該數據庫,選擇“導出”選項。

2、在打開的導出嚮導中,選擇導出文件的路徑和文件名,以及導出格式(例如SQL文件)。

3、按照提示進行下一步操作,等待導出過程結束即可。

四、mysql導入sql文件命令

與導出命令類似,MySQL也提供了導入命令來將SQL文件導入到MySQL數據庫中。示例代碼如下:

mysql -u用戶名 -p密碼 數據庫名 < 導入文件名

其中,用戶名和密碼分別是你的MySQL登錄賬戶和密碼,數據庫名是你要將數據導入的目標數據庫名稱,導入文件名是你要導入的SQL文件名稱,需要加文件後綴。運行該命令後,MySQL會將SQL文件中的數據導入到指定的數據庫中。

五、mysql命令行導出sql文件

除了使用mysqldump命令進行導出外,還可以通過MySQL命令行進行導出。具體步驟如下:

1、打開MySQL命令行,並登錄到MySQL數據庫。

2、執行以下命令:

USE 數據庫名;
SOURCE 要導出的SQL文件名;

其中,數據庫名是你要導出的數據庫名稱,要導出的SQL文件名是你要導出的SQL文件的路徑和文件名,需要加文件後綴。執行該命令後,MySQL會將SQL文件中的數據導入到指定的數據庫中。

六、mysql導入文件命令

在MySQL中,使用LOAD DATA INFILE命令可以將數據從文件中導入到數據庫中。具體步驟如下:

1、創建一個用於導入數據的表。

CREATE TABLE 表名 (列名1 數據類型1, 列名2 數據類型2,...);

2、執行以下命令,將文件中的數據導入到表中:

LOAD DATA INFILE '文件路徑' INTO TABLE 表名;

其中,文件路徑是要導入的文件路徑和文件名,需要加文件後綴,表名是你創建的用於導入數據的表名稱。執行該命令後,MySQL會將文件中的數據導入到指定的表中。

七、mysql導出sql文件拒絕訪問

在使用mysqldump命令導出SQL文件時,有時會出現“拒絕訪問”等錯誤提示。這是由於導出文件的路徑沒有寫入權限造成的。解決方法是在導出文件的路徑上增加寫入權限。示例代碼如下:

mysqldump -u用戶名 -p密碼 數據庫名 > 導出文件路徑 2>&1

其中,導出文件路徑是你要導出的SQL文件的路徑和文件名,需要加文件後綴。在路徑後面加上2>&1可以將錯誤輸出定向到標準輸出流中,從而可以看到具體的錯誤信息。

八、mysql導出整個數據庫

如果想要導出整個數據庫,可以在mysqldump命令中指定–all-databases選項。示例代碼如下:

mysqldump -u用戶名 -p密碼 --all-databases > 導出文件名

其中,用戶名和密碼分別是你的MySQL登錄賬戶和密碼,導出文件名是你自己指定的導出文件名稱,不需要加文件後綴。執行該命令後,MySQL會將整個數據庫導出到指定的文件中。

原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hant/n/152775.html

(0)
打賞 微信掃一掃 微信掃一掃 支付寶掃一掃 支付寶掃一掃
小藍的頭像小藍
上一篇 2024-11-13 06:07
下一篇 2024-11-13 06:07

相關推薦

發表回復

登錄後才能評論